Water-resistant, not a submersion dry bag
Built for damp, not for dripping or soaking
The PUL fabric is water-resistant and contains moisture from damp items — swimsuits you've wrung out, sweaty clothes, used cloth diapers, wet towels. It's not a sealed dry bag designed to hold standing water or items that are actively dripping. Wring out soaking items before putting them in so the bag isn't holding loose liquid. For kayaking or submersion use, a roll-top dry bag is the right tool. For normal wet-items-coming-home-from-somewhere use, this is exactly what it needs to be.

Care
Washing and drying
Machine washable No bleach or fabric softeners Hang dry or tumble low Hundreds of washes
Machine wash with regular detergent, warm or cold. Avoid bleach and fabric softeners — softeners coat PUL and reduce its water resistance over time. Hang drying is gentlest on the fabric and extends the life of the waterproof layer; tumble dry on low is fine for regular use. The bag dries quickly either way — usually ready to reuse within a few hours of hanging.

Is the bag completely waterproof?
It's water-resistant, not sealed. The PUL fabric contains moisture from damp items — wet swimsuits, used diapers, sweaty clothes — without the contents soaking through to the outside. It's not designed to hold standing water or submerged items. For that kind of use (kayaking, beach gear in wet sand) a sealed roll-top dry bag is the better choice.
Can I put soaking wet items inside?
Wring out anything that's actively dripping before it goes in, so the bag isn't sitting with standing water at the bottom. Damp items — a wrung-out swimsuit, sweaty workout clothes, a used cloth diaper — go in as-is. The fabric contains the moisture, but it isn't designed to pool liquid.
How long does it last?
With regular use and proper care (no fabric softener or bleach, hang dry when possible), PUL wet bags typically last multiple years. The fabric holds up through hundreds of wash cycles without losing water resistance. Zippers and seams are usually what show wear first, well after the bag has paid for itself many times over vs. disposable plastic.
